Bingo jackpot winner heads to Disneyland

Free bingo fan destined for Disneyland
A free bingo fan who claimed part of a quarter-of-a-million-pound jackpot has set her sights on visiting Disneyland.
It may surprise online bingo lovers to learn that the player in question, Lynda McNamara, has already reached the ripe old age of 64 years old - not exactly the target audience of Mickey Mouse, Buzz Lightyear and friends.
But of course this trip is not really for Lynda herself, it's a treat for her grandchildren, reports the Hounslow Chronicle.
She took home a £3,906.25 payout after a fellow player hit the jackpot at a nearby bingo club.
The lucky Hounslow lady, a regular member who wishes to remain anonymous, scooped the £3,000 full house prize and an additional jackpot worth an astonishing £125,000.
This made it the largest individual win in the bingo club's history.
And because she completed her bingo ticket in double-quick time, the other 32 players in the club also got to share a separate £125,000 prize fund.
Lynda recalls bingo bedlam
One of those lucky winners was Lynda, who has recalled the thrilling moment when the shout of 'bingo' rang out.
"When we realised that we were all winners too, you would have thought there were a thousand people in the room with all the noise," she said.
"I plan to take my grandchildren to Disneyland, which I would have never been able to afford without this win. It really has been life changing for us all."
